Transaction 8e0960f576c6b743cc3c26d91d6f209d55b56dcc0fa979ffce2a256303e36aeb
1 Input
1 Output
-
8e0960f576c6b743cc3c26d91d6f209d55b56dcc0fa979ffce2a256303e36aeb:0
- value
- 649342
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ff0501abb0c66675d86f3540ee6d3cd8ea865b05 OP_EQUAL
- address
- 3QwSEKWrziaoUHeKrF6Yf6GKMSVFN436sP